angle |
the figure made by two lines coming from a single point. |
client |
one who pays for the services of another. |
creation |
the act of making something or causing something to exist. |
credit |
the quality or condition of being able to be believed or trusted. |
fertilize |
to spread fertilizer over (a planted area). |
handicap |
anything that makes things harder or keeps one from doing better. |
insurance |
a protection against certain accidents that is provided by a company in return for payment of a fee. |
judge |
a person trained to hear and decide cases brought before a court of law. |
lug |
to pull, lift, or carry with a great effort. |
nibble |
to eat in small bites. |
persistent |
continuing, lasting, or holding on in a firm, steady way. |
repair |
to put in good condition again after damage has been done; fix. |
stale |
having lost its taste or moisture; not fresh. |
unfortunate |
having bad luck; unlucky. |
wink |
to close and open one eye quickly, as a sign of agreement or friendliness. |
